2024-2025学年南京市联合体英语八年级上册期末试卷
一、听力(略)
二、单项填空(共10小题; 每小题1分,满分10分)
从A、B、C、D四个选项中,选出可以填入空白处的最佳选项。
1. There were all kinds of thoughts running through Daniel’s ________ after he heard the news.
A. body B. mind C. memory D. sense
【答案】B
【解析】
【详解】句意:丹尼尔听到这个消息后,各种想法在他脑海中闪过。
考查名词辨析。body身体;mind头脑,思想;memory记忆;sense感觉,感官。根据“thoughts running through Daniel’s…”可知,应该是各种想法在脑海中闪现,故选B。
2. Jack seldom did any sports, but now he starts to exercise every day and becomes ________.
A. careful B. modest C. energetic D. curious
【答案】C
【解析】
【详解】句意:杰克很少做运动,但现在他开始每天锻炼,变得精力充沛。
考查形容词辨析。careful小心的;modest谦虚的;energetic精力充沛的;curious好奇的。根据“but now he starts to exercise every day”可知,Jack开始每天锻炼,锻炼通常会让人变得有活力。故选C。
3. — Kitty, how much do you know about The Book of Songs?
— It is the ________ collection of poems in China and the beginning of China’s poetry tradition.
A. earlier B. earliest C. later D. last
【答案】B
【解析】
【详解】句意:——基蒂,你对《诗经》了解多少?——它是中国最早的诗歌集,也是中国诗歌传统的开端。
考查比较等级及形容词辨析。earlier更早的;earliest最早的;later稍后;last最后的。“the”后接最高级,结合常识可知,《诗经》是中国最早的诗歌总集,此处用“earliest”。故选B。
4. Animals are important in our lives. ________ , our actions make many kinds of animals in danger.
A. Moreover B. Otherwise C. Also D. However
【答案】D
【解析】
【详解】句意:在我们的生活中,动物是重要的。然而,我们的行为却使许多种类的动物处于危险中。
考查副词辨析。moreover而且;otherwise否则;also也;however然而。根据“Animals are important in our lives”和“our actions make many kinds of animals in danger”可知,前后是转折关系,however “然而”,符合语境。故选D。
5. —I tried again and again, but I still failed.
— Don’t be sad. You should learn to ________ the result and keep trying.
A. accept B. prevent C. support D. describe
【答案】A
【解析】
【详解】句意:——我试了一次又一次,但还是失败了。——别难过。你应该学会接受结果并继续努力。
考查动词辨析。accept接受;prevent阻止;support支持;describe描述。根据“but I still failed”以及“keep trying”可知,失败后要学会接受失败的结果再继续努力,“accept”符合语境,故选A。
6. — I called you yesterday, but you didn’t answer.
— Sorry. I ________ a report on animal protection.
A. read B. am reading C. was reading D. will read
【答案】C
【解析】
【详解】句意:——昨天我给你打电话,但是你没有接。——抱歉。我正在读一个关于动物保护的报道。
考查过去进行时。根据“yesterday”和“but you didn’t answer”可知,此处表示过去某一时刻正在发生事情,时态为过去进行时,其谓语结构为“was/were+doing”,主语为I,be动词用was,故选C。
7. Which of the following words is formed in the same way as “toothache”?
A. hunting B. careless C. unhappy D. pancake
【答案】D
【解析】
【详解】句意:下列哪个单词的构成方式与“toothache”相同?
考查构词法。hunting打猎;careless粗心的;unhappy不开心的;pancake薄饼。toothache是由tooth和ache组合而成的复合词。hunting是hunt的动名词形式;careless是care加否定后缀-less构成的形容词;unhappy是否定前缀un-加happy开心构成的形容词;pancake是由pan和cake组合而成的复合词,与toothache的构成方式相同。故选D。
8. The snowstorm will hit our city this weekend. Be careful that your car may ________.
A. put down B. come down C. break down D. calm down
【答案】C
【解析】
【详解】句意:暴风雪这个周末将会袭击我们的城市。小心你的车可能会出故障。
考查动词短语。put down放下,镇压,记下;come down下来;break down出故障,分解;calm down平静下来。根据“The snowstorm will hit our city this weekend.”可知,暴风雪可能会对车辆造成影响,使车辆出现故障,break down“出故障”,符合语境。故选C。
9. Which of the following has the same sentence structure as “Tom makes some boys laugh”?
A. Tom is a kind and helpful boy.
B. Tom is singing in his room now.
C. Tom bought his mother a present.
D Tom often watches Mike play the piano.
【答案】D
【解析】
【详解】句意:以下哪个句子结构与“汤姆让一些男孩笑”相同?
考查句子结构。Tom is a kind and helpful boy.是“主系表”结构;Tom is singing in his room now.是“主谓”结构;Tom bought his mother a present.是“主谓双宾”结构;Tom often watches Mike play the piano.是“主谓宾宾补”结构。“Tom makes some boys laugh”是 “主语+谓语+宾语+宾补” 结构,与选项D结构相同。故选D。
10. —Do you still remember the science lesson from China’s Tiangong Space Station last year?
—________. It was so amazing that I would never forget it.
A. All right B. Of course C. Certainly not D. Come on
【答案】B
【解析】
【详解】句意:——你还记得去年中国天宫空间站的科学课吗?——当然。它是如此令人惊叹,我永远也不会忘记。
考查情景交际。All right好吧;Of course当然;Certainly not当然不;Come on加油。根据“It was so amazing that I would never forget it.”可知,说话者不会忘记那堂课,所以此处应用“当然”回答,表示对上文提问的肯定回答。故选B。

C
Wake up early enough and you may hear a pleasant chorus of birds singing their tiny hearts out. This is a natural thing for birds, but why?
According to the Woodland Trust, this early singing can start as early as 4 a.m. and last for several hours. Birds do it to attract mates and ask other birds to stay away from their area. One idea about why they choose the early morning to send these important messages is because the low visibility (能见度) makes it hard to do other bird activities, like hunting food. Since there’s nothing to do, they choose to sing instead.
Another idea is that birds use the morning songs to show a picture of strong body. By singing, they’re letting other birds know they’ve survived (存活) the night and would make for an excellent mate.
Like a good recording studio, the early morning hours also let birds send clear sounds thanks to the cooler, drier air. As birds have different voices, that helps other birds nearby identify them more easily.
There used to be a popular idea that birds sang so much in the mornings because the sounds could travel to farther places with less air turbulence (气流). But researchers at the University of Western Ontario proved (证明) it wrong in 2003. They played recordings of sparrows at dawn (early morning) and midday. The songs didn’t travel farther, but they were more consistent (连贯的). Because birds only have so much energy to sing out, singing when it can be heard makes sense. For a bird, the early morning singing is like having the wonderful sound environment for their performance.

Background knowledge (知识) is the knowledge a person has about the world when he or she starts to read a text. It is agreed that background knowledge is of great importance in reading. In short, the more you know about a topic, the easier it is for you to read a text, understand it, and remember the information.
To understand this, here are two points. First, background knowledge enables readers to choose between different meanings of words. For example, if you read the word “operation” in a sports article, you might think about a sportsperson with a serious injury. But if you read the word in a math text, you’d think about a mathematical process. Second, understanding a text needs readers to fill missing information and make further understanding. To do this, readers need to have some basic (基本的) knowledge about the topic.
Students get background knowledge both through personal experiences (经历) and by learning in the classroom. Then how can teachers help students build background knowledge? Here is some advice.
Begin by teaching words in categories (种类). For example, teachers can try something as easy as this: apples, bananas, strawberries, mangoes. They are a type of...(fruit). Categories of objects can help students increase the number of new words.
Encourage (鼓励) topic-centred wide reading. Reading builds knowledge, but wide reading has usually been taken as reading about a lot of different topics. Teachers can try a different way: Encourage children to find an interest and read as many books as they can on one topic. This will help them get a deeper knowledge on a topic.
Use multimedia (多媒体). Direct experiences are the most effective ways to build knowledge. There is nothing more exciting for students than learning through direct experiences, such as field trips and other activities. Although multimedia cannot take the place of real-life experiences, it can often provide a lot of information that we could only wish to experience first-hand. It can also introduce children to important words.
Background knowledge is important in a student’s ability to fully understand a text. Teachers’ hard work can help students become stronger thinkers and life-long readers and learners.
